Transaction 630abe3cc8e4ac1cca932a3e54860e3d44dac4209e9006454b5a5fcc346591fd
2 Input
2 Outputs
- 630abe3cc8e4ac1cca932a3e54860e3d44dac4209e9006454b5a5fcc346591fd:0
- 630abe3cc8e4ac1cca932a3e54860e3d44dac4209e9006454b5a5fcc346591fd:1
value 598425
address 18benEf1TPK28wcVSaGupCVZoi63Wzt5SP
value 4086707
address 17PPN6s8qudrjuEPYfsjiB9hUxnNkJHPd9